What is minimalist decoration?
Minimalist decoration is an interior design style based on the concept of simplicity, where "less is more." This philosophy seeks to eliminate excess and highlight essential elements, creating spaces with a sense of calm, order, and fluidity.
In minimalist style, spaces are composed of few furniture pieces and objects, but each item is carefully chosen for its functionality and aesthetics. The goal is to create a visually clean and organized space without losing sophistication.
With the growing demand for more functional spaces, minimalism has become a global trend. These spaces are often characterized by neutral tones, simple lines, geometric shapes, and natural materials such as stone, wood, and metals.
What are the fundamental principles of minimalism in interior decoration?
To successfully apply minimalist decoration, it's essential to follow some key principles:
- Simplicity and functionality: Every item in the space should have a clear and essential purpose. The idea is to avoid clutter and unnecessary furniture. Furniture is chosen for its utility and clean design, ensuring practicality and comfort.
- Neutral color palette: Shades like white, gray, black, and beige dominate, creating a calm and sophisticated base. More vibrant colors can be introduced sparingly through objects or accents that add life to the space without overwhelming it.
- Open and organized spaces: Minimalism values a sense of spaciousness, so areas should be well-organized and free of obstructions. Multifunctional furniture is an excellent way to keep the space free of unnecessary items.
- Use of natural materials: Materials like wood, stone, and metals are highly valued in minimalism. They add a tactile and sophisticated dimension to spaces while maintaining the style's characteristic restraint.
- Natural lighting: The more natural light, the better. Minimalist style seeks to maximize daylight, creating a light and airy atmosphere. To achieve this, prioritize large windows, sheer curtains that let sunlight in, and lighting that complements the space.

How to decorate a minimalist space: 5 ideas for each room in the house
1. Master bedroom
In a minimalist bedroom, multifunctional furniture is essential. Choose a bed with a wooden headboard, a small nightstand, and bedding in neutral tones like white, gray, or beige.
Another great option is using Biancatto marble for the nightstand or headboard, adding sophistication and brightness to the space.
2. Minimalist living room

In a minimalist living room, simplicity should stand out. Choose a sofa with straight lines, preferably in neutral tones like gray or white, and add a simple rug and a few cushions for comfort.
Mont Blanc quartzite can be used for flooring or a coffee table, adding a touch of softness and elegance.
3. Minimalist kitchen
In the kitchen, opt for handleless custom cabinets to create a clean and organized look. Marble or quartz countertops or wall coverings add a contemporary yet minimalist touch.
4. Children's bedroom
In a child's bedroom, minimalist decoration can still be functional and fun. Choose simple furniture and soft tones.
Mystic Blue quartzite or Pink Crystal can be used for wall coverings in blue or pink tones, or as decorative accents, creating a light and cheerful space without excess.
5. Sophisticated bathroom
A minimalist bathroom should be clean and cozy. Combine stones like Mont Blanc for flooring and dark Incognitus quartzite for countertops. Pairing these stones with simple fixtures and natural lighting creates a relaxing, high-end atmosphere.

Pay attention to the types of natural stones and their recommended applications: Knowing the types of stones and their recommended applications is an essential point for you to determine which product will be chosen. Check out the main recommendations for each type below: Quartzite: extremely resistant, quartzite can be used in a variety of environments, both indoors as flooring, countertops, and panels, or outdoors like pools, facades, and outdoor fireplace cladding. They come in a wide range of colors, patterns, and textures, adding refinement and originality to projects; Granite: with scratch resistance and easy installation, granite is a type of stone that also has a wide range of applications, whether for outdoor or indoor areas, ensuring beauty to projects; Marble: from classic patterns, marble elegantly complements indoor spaces, being suitable for applications like floors, walls, and furniture, as well as exterior fireplace cladding and tabletops; Travertine: known for being a timeless and versatile stone, travertine can be used in indoor spaces like panels and floors, or in outdoor areas such as facades and pool edges. With a velvety texture and neutral colors, it provides versatility and elegance to the project. Take into consideration the texture you wish to use. In addition to the broad patterns and veins that natural rocks possess, there is the possibility of varying the applied textures, bringing a fresh perspective to the product. Among the various possible finishes, we mention polished, which imparts a shiny and mirrored aspect to the material; brushed, characterized by a velvety and satin-like texture; honed, ensuring a matte and smooth appearance; flamed, providing a more rustic, raw finish to the stone. Stay informed about cleaning and maintenance tips for the material. Besides ensuring the best standard and texture of your material, remember that it is essential to know how to protect your natural stone. Avoid using abrasive or chemically aggressive cleaning products and always prefer detergents with a neutral pH. Keep reading and discover the various possibilities that quartzite can offer according to your goals. What is quartzite? Quartzite is a type of natural rock found in several Brazilian states. Formed from highly resistant sedimentary rocks, it is composed of 75% quartz and 25% other elements such as tourmaline, muscovite, biotite, among others. With unique patterns, it has a uniform and clean base, making it perfect for creating modern projects where minimalist aesthetics are the focal point. What are the advantages of quartzite? Here are the main benefits of using quartzite in your projects: Resistance: Due to its low absorption and high quartz content, which provides high hardness, quartzite has a wide range of applications. Finishes: Being a natural rock, quartzite can receive various finishes on its surface, such as polished, honed, brushed, flamed, or raw. Varied colors and prominent veins: Quartzite can be found in a wide variety of colors, with distinctive and original veins and tones. Easy to clean: Only water and mild soap are needed to clean this rock. As it doesn't absorb liquids, immediate cleaning is not necessary. How to use quartzite in projects? This natural rock can be applied in different areas of the house. Here are some great examples of applications that look amazing: In bathrooms, it can be used on the sink countertop or as a wall covering in the shower area. In kitchens, the classic use is as a countertop and supporting counter, also serving as a product for kitchen islands. In living rooms and bedrooms, it stands out as a wall covering, especially on focal walls within the space, such as behind the bed or TV wall. In outdoor areas, such as flooring, it is recommended to apply a special treatment to the surface of the rock to prevent it from becoming slippery.
